The WACC (weighted average cost of capital) is the average interest rate that a company should pay in order to secure a project. Moreover, WACC is the average rate of return that a company must earn from its current assets to satisfy investors, shareholders and creditors. Since FedEx Corporation is always trying to create value for shareholders, the paper calculates the WACC of the FedEx to evaluate the company ability to generate returns from its assets.

As being revealed in Table 1, the short-term debt of FedEx Corporation is approximately $4,645 Million. The paper estimates that the market value of the company short-term debt is equal to the book value. Based on this estimation, the market value of the company short-term debt is $4,645 Million.
However, estimation of the company market value for the company long-term debts is different from the estimation of the short-term debt. As being revealed in the FedEx Corporation consolidated balance sheet 2010, the FedEx long-term debts are not traded. To calculate the market value of the company long-term debts, the paper considers what the potential lenders require at present as a reasonable yield to maturity. The paper assumes that the yield of the company short-term debts is zero. However, the yield of the company long-term debts should be reasonably above the yields of the government bonds and notes. The present yields of government bonds and notes are 3.38%, and given the status and business position of FedEx Corporation, the required yield to maturity will be reasonably above the yield of the government bonds. The report assumes that the yield of the FedEx long-term debt will be 5%.
As being recorded in the 2010 consolidated balance sheet, the company total long — term debts are $4,778 Million carrying the interest of 5% per year and the paper estimates the maturity of these debts to be 6 years.
To calculate the market value of the company long-term debts using the required yield of 5%, the market value of the company long-term debts would be equal to the present value of the cash flow, and discounted at 5% will be as follows:

Equity
The market value of the equity of the FedEx is calculated by multiplying the company common outstanding shares by today’s market price per share. In May 31, 2010, the company issued 312 million common outstanding shares, and today price of the company outstanding shares is $138.10.
Thu, the market value of the company of the equity is as follows:
V=312 million x 138.10.
V=$43,087.2 Million
The paper assumes that 6% is the yield of the company outstanding shares. Thus, the cost of equity is 6% x $43,087.2 Million
Cost of Equity =$2,585.23 Million.
The report now calculates the WACC using the following formula:
WACC = “(E/V) X Re + (D/V) X Rd X (1 — Tc)”
Where:
Re = Cost of equity
Rd = Cost of debt
E = “Market value of the firm’s equity”
D = “Market value of the firm’s debt”
V = E + D
E/V = “Percentage of financing that is equity”
D/V = “Percentage of financing that is debt”
TC = Corporate tax rate
